Configuring Oracle Utilities SOAP UCM Gen Svc for WACS-FPRC Connection
This connection is used to communicate with Oracle Universal Content Management using the SOAP adapter.
To configure the Oracle Utilities SOAP UCM Gen Svc for WACS-FPRC connection:
1. Specify the WSDL URL.
The Oracle UCM Web Service follows this format: https://{ERP Cloud host}/idcws/GenericSoapPort?WSDL
2. From the Security Policy drop-down list, select Basic Authentication.
3. Provide Username and Password to connect to Oracle UCM.
4. Click Test at the upper-right corner.
5. After the connection is tested successfully, click Save.
Configuring Oracle Utilities REST WACS for WACS-FPRC Connection
This connection is used to communicate with Oracle Utilities Work and Asset Cloud Service using the Oracle Utilities Adapter.
To configure the Oracle Utilities REST WACS for WACS-FPRC connection:
1. Specify the Oracle Utilities Work and Asset Cloud Service REST web catalog in the catalogURL section.
The REST Catalog URL follows this format: https://{host}:{port}/{tenant}/{domain}/{appName}/rest/openapi/iws/catalog
2. In the Security Policy drop-down list, select Basic Authentication.
3. Provide Username and Password to connect to Oracle Utilities Work and Asset Cloud Service.
4. Click Test at the upper-right corner.
5. After the connection is tested successfully, click Save.
Configuring Oracle Utilities REST for WACS-FPRC Connection
This connection is used as a REST trigger.
To configure the REST for WACS-FPRC connection:
1. In the Security Policy section, select OAuth2.0 or Basic Authentication.
2. Click Test.
3. After the connection is tested successfully, click Save.
Configuring Oracle Utilities ERP Cloud for WACS-FPRC Connection
This connection is used to communicate with Oracle ERP Fusion Cloud application using the Oracle ERP Cloud Adapter.
To configure the Oracle ERP Financial Cloud for WACS-FPRC connection:
1. Enter the ERP Cloud Host URL.
Example: https://ERP_domain_name.fa.DC.oraclecloud.com
Note: The Oracle ERP Cloud host name can easily be derived from the Oracle ERP Cloud login URL.
2. In the Security Policy section, select Username Password Token.
3. Enter the Username and Password to connect to Oracle ERP Financial Cloud.
4. Click Test.
5. After the connection is tested successfully, click Save.
